wordpress 整合phpbb
时间 : 2024-05-02 17:40:02声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

最佳答案

WordPress作为全球最流行的内容管理系统(CMS),提供了一个友好且易于使用的平台,方便用户创建和管理网站内容。而PHPBB(PHP Bulletin Board)则是一个流行的开源论坛软件,可以轻松创建和管理网站上的论坛功能。将WordPress与PHPBB整合,可以为网站提供更丰富的交互性和社区功能。下面将详细介绍如何将WordPress整合PHPBB,并分层次阐述整合的步骤和原理。

1. 安装WordPress插件

WordPress提供了一些插件可帮助整合PHPBB。用户可以在WordPress后台的插件页面中搜索并安装相关插件,例如"WP phpBB Bridge"或"phpBB Single Sign-On"。这些插件可以帮助实现用户在WordPress和PHPBB之间的统一登录和用户信息同步,从而方便用户在两个平台间切换而无需重复登录。

2. 配置phpBB单点登录

在PHPBB的后台管理页面中,用户需要进行一些设置来配置单点登录。通过修改PHPBB的配置文件或者使用相关插件,用户可以指定WordPress的登录页面为主登录页面,并将登录验证交由WordPress来处理。这样用户在登录WordPress后即可无缝地访问PHPBB的论坛功能,实现了单一身份认证。

3. 同步用户信息

为了确保用户在WordPress和PHPBB之间的一致性,用户需要进行用户信息同步的配置。这包括同步用户的用户名、邮箱、密码等信息,并确保在用户在一处进行了修改后,另一处信息也能得到更新。通过相关插件或者自定义代码,用户可以实现用户信息的同步,保证用户在两个系统中的一致性。

4. 集成评论和帖子功能

一旦用户完成了登录和用户信息同步的整合,接下来可以考虑整合评论和帖子功能。用户可以在WordPress中的帖子下方插入PHPBB的论坛链接或者嵌入论坛的帖子列表,让用户能够方便地在文章页直接参与讨论。同时,用户在PHPBB中发表的帖子也可以显示在WordPress的相关页面中,从而实现了两个系统之间的内容互通。

5. 定制主题和风格一致

用户可以考虑定制主题和风格,使得WordPress和PHPBB在外观上保持一致。通过调整CSS样式或者选择统一的配色方案,用户可以确保用户在两个系统间切换时不会感到突兀,提升整体的用户体验。

通过以上的整合步骤,用户可以将WordPress和PHPBB两个系统完美地整合在一起,实现了用户信息和内容的无缝互通。这种整合方式不仅能提升网站的交互性和社区功能,也能为用户提供更加一体化的用户体验,使得网站更具吸引力和活力。WordPress整合PHPBB的过程需要一定的技术水平和梳理。建议用户在操作前先进行彻底的备份,以避免意外情况发生。

其他答案

WordPress是目前全球最流行的内容管理系统之一,它的易用性和灵活性使其成为了许多网站建设者的首选。而PHPBB则是一款广泛应用的免费开源论坛系统,具有丰富的社区功能和扩展性。通过将WordPress与PHPBB整合起来,可以实现网站内容和社区功能的有机结合,为用户提供更丰富的互动体验。下面将分层次阐述如何将WordPress整合PHPBB。

**1. 准备工作:**

在整合WordPress与PHPBB之前,首先需要进行一些准备工作。确保你已经安装了最新版本的WordPress和PHPBB,并且两者的数据库设置和网站地址等信息都正确无误。另外,也需要确保你有足够的权限来修改WordPress和PHPBB的文件,并有一定的PHP和数据库知识。

**2. 单一登陆集成:**

一项重要的整合工作是实现单一登录系统,即用户在WordPress中的登录状态可以同步到PHPBB中,从而实现一次登录,多处适用。要实现这一目标,可以使用WordPress的用户认证机制来控制PHPBB的登录状态,并确保用户在WordPress中的注册和更改密码等操作也会同步到PHPBB中。

**3. 主题整合:**

你可以调整WordPress和PHPBB的主题样式,使得它们在外观上更加一致。这样可以增强整体用户体验,让用户在两个平台间切换时感受到更加统一的视觉风格,提升整体网站的专业感和品牌形象。

**4. 内容整合:**

你可以在WordPress中嵌入PHPBB的论坛板块,或者在PHPBB的论坛页面中显示来自WordPress的相关内容。这样可以实现网站内容和论坛社区的深度融合,帮助用户更便捷地浏览和参与讨论,并增强网站的粘性和用户互动性。

**5. 数据库整合:**

通过调整数据库设置,可以实现WordPress和PHPBB的数据共享,比如用户信息、评论信息等可以在两个系统之间相互访问和使用。这样可以避免数据冗余和不一致,提高数据管理的效率和一致性。

**6. 功能整合:**

你可以通过插件或者自定义开发来实现一些功能的整合,比如在WordPress页面中显示最新的论坛帖子,或者在PHPBB论坛中实现文章评论的显示。这样可以增加网站的互动性和内容丰富度,提升用户留存和参与度。

通过以上的分层次阐述,整合WordPress与PHPBB的过程可以更加清晰和易于理解。综合利用两者的优势,实现内容和社区的有机结合,将会为网站用户带来更加丰富和完善的体验,提升网站的整体价值和竞争力。